What Are Omega-3 Fatty Acids?
Omega-3 fatty acids are essential fats that our bodies cannot produce on their own, which means we must obtain them from our diet. The primary types of omega-3 fatty acids are:
– EPA (Eicosapentaenoic Acid)
– DHA (Docosahexaenoic Acid)
– ALA (Alpha-Linolenic Acid)
These fatty acids are predominantly found in fish oil, flaxseeds, chia seeds, and walnuts. Omega-3s are renowned for their numerous health benefits, including:
– Heart Health: Omega-3 fatty acids have been shown to reduce triglycerides, lower blood pressure, and decrease the risk of heart disease.
– Brain Function: DHA, in particular, is a critical component of brain tissue and is associated with improved cognitive function and mental health.
– Anti-inflammatory Properties: Omega-3s can help reduce inflammation in the body, which is linked to various chronic diseases.
The Importance of Zinc
Zinc is a vital trace mineral that plays a crucial role in numerous bodily functions. It is essential for:
– Immune Function: Zinc is known to boost the immune system, helping the body fight off infections and illnesses.
– Wound Healing: This mineral is important for skin health and plays a role in wound healing processes.
– Protein Synthesis and DNA Synthesis: Zinc is integral to the production of proteins and the replication of DNA, making it vital for growth and development.
Despite its importance, many people do not get enough zinc through their diet, which can lead to deficiencies and various health issues.
